Output 3008fd292c74bc256ea81b53f385f174764cf63338a43b9c31b1d307257faaae:1

value
2859
script pubkey
OP_0 OP_PUSHBYTES_20 8d4d85448bbacd52d89b48cda615eaa667322066
address
bc1q34xc23ythtx49kymfrx6v9025ennygrx3umn0p
transaction
3008fd292c74bc256ea81b53f385f174764cf63338a43b9c31b1d307257faaae
confirmations
143962
spent
true